python如何导入.csv文件并处理
时间: 2024-09-06 07:08:04 浏览: 81
在Python中,导入并处理.csv文件通常会使用`pandas`库,这是一个强大的数据处理库,非常适合于数据分析。以下是使用`pandas`导入和处理.csv文件的基本步骤:
1. 首先确保安装了`pandas`库,如果没有安装,可以使用pip命令安装:
```bash
pip install pandas
```
2. 导入`pandas`库并使用`read_csv`函数读取.csv文件:
```python
import pandas as pd
# 假设文件名为example.csv,位于同一目录下
df = pd.read_csv('example.csv')
```
3. 使用`read_csv`函数读取数据后,返回的是一个`DataFrame`对象,可以使用`DataFrame`的各种方法来处理数据:
- 查看数据的前几行:`df.head()`
- 查看数据的统计摘要:`df.describe()`
- 数据筛选和查询:`df[df['列名'] > 某个值]`
- 数据排序:`df.sort_values(by='列名', ascending=False)`
- 数据分组和聚合:`df.groupby('列名').agg(聚合函数)`
- 处理缺失值:`df.fillna(填充值)` 或 `df.dropna()`
- 数据合并:`pd.merge()` 或 `df.concat()`
4. 处理完数据后,如果需要将数据保存回.csv文件,可以使用`to_csv`方法:
```python
df.to_csv('output.csv', index=False) # index=False表示在输出文件中不包含行索引
```
阅读全文